Creating a Functional and Beautiful Home: Furniture Tips and Tricks

Furnishing your home is read more a fun journey that blends comfort with style. To make your space both functional and visually appealing, consider these helpful tips and tricks:

First, pinpoint the purpose of each room. A living room might call for comfortable seating arrangements for gatherings, while a bedroom demands a serene atmosphere with a comfortable bed.

Next, think about scale. Choose furniture that is appropriate to the room's size to avoid overcrowding or making it feel empty. Don't be afraid to mix and match different styles and textures to create a individual look.

  • Don't forget about functionality! Choose pieces with hidden storage to maximize space.
  • Incorporate bold shades through cushions, throws, and artwork to enhance the space.
  • Pay attention to lighting. Use a mix of light sources, including overhead lighting, lamps, and natural light, to create a welcoming ambiance.

Finally, play around until you achieve a layout and design that reflects your personal style and satisfies your needs. Remember, your home should be a place where you feel relaxed, happy, and motivated.
